AAA projects nearly 44 million to travel Memorial Day weekend; record 38 million expected to travel by car
More than 43.8 million travelers will head 50 miles or more from home over the Memorial Day holiday travel period from Thursday, May 23 to Monday, May 27 according to AAA projections. US State Department issues worldwide travel warning ahead of Pride month
The US State Department issued a “Worldwide Caution” alert on Friday warning US citizens overseas to exercise increased caution amid fears of potential terrorist-inspired violence against LGBTQI+ persons and events.
